5. Empowerment Council (CAMH Consumer/Survivor Systemic Advocate Organization) in the News

The Empowerment Council was an intervenor in this legal case that took on the question of whether the Ontario Review Board had the authority to order other branch of government to pay for psychiatric assessments:

6. Report on Research on Mental Health and Micronutrients

This news article about a New Zealand research study into the use of a 36-ingredient formula of micronutrients (vitamins, minerals, and amino acids) found encouraging improvement in test subjects with diagnoses of att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) and mood disorders:

7. The Law as it Affects Persons with Disabilities (Call for Papers)

The Law Commission of Ontario is in the midst of a project to develop a systemic framework on legal issues as it affects persons with disabilities.  They are soliciting requests for proposals for funding research that will be in the form of papers that address certain themes.  You can find out more here:
